Thermal Shutdown
Thermal shutdown function is included in the R1150HxxxA/B/C/D Series, when the junction temperature is
equal or more than +150°C (Typ.), the operation of regulator would stop. After that, when the junction
temperature is equal or less than +120°C (Typ.), the operation of regulator would restart. Unless the cause of
rising temperature would remove, the regulator repeats on and off, and output waveform would be like
consecutive pulses.
Chip Enable Circuit
Do not make voltage level of chip enable pin keep floating level, or in between VIH and VIL. Unless otherwise,
Output voltage would be unstable or indefinite, or unexpected current would flow internally.
Output Delay Time for Release VDET
In the R1150Hxx1C/D can set an output delay time for release voltage detector with connecting a capacitor to
CD pin. When an input voltage (in the case of R1150Hxx1C) or an output voltage (in the case of R1150Hxx1D)
surpasses the release voltage of its voltage detector (+VDET), the capacitor which is connected to CD pin is started
to be charged, as a result, CD pin voltage rises. When the CD pin voltage surpasses CD pin threshold voltage, the
output voltage of the voltage detector outputs “H”.

Output delay time for release voltage detector can be calculated with the next formula:
tPLH=1.25/200×109×CD (sec)
Input Transient Response
If the input transient speed is equal or faster than 80mV/μs and the transient level difference is equal or more
than 1.5V, the output response may be extremely worse than normal operation. In that case, add a capacitor
between VIN and GND, and make the transient speed of VIN slower than 80mV/µs.
